🎉 New Year, New Skills! Get 25% off on all our courses – Start learning today! 🎉 | Ends in: GRAB NOW

What Is Stress Testing in Software Testing

Software Testing

What Is Stress Testing in Software Testing

Exploring Stress Testing in Software Testing

What Is Stress Testing in Software Testing

Stress testing in software testing is a crucial technique used to evaluate the reliability and stability of a system under extreme conditions. By subjecting the software to high levels of stress, such as heavy loads, high data volumes, or peak usage scenarios, stress testing helps identify potential weaknesses, bottlenecks, and failures that may occur in real-world situations. This type of testing allows software developers to proactively address performance issues and ensure that the system can handle unexpected spikes in user activity, thereby enhancing the overall quality and user experience of the software product.

To Download Our Brochure: https://www.justacademy.co/download-brochure-for-free

Message us for more information: +91 9987184296

1 - Stress testing in software testing is a type of non functional testing that evaluates the software's robustness and stability under extreme conditions beyond its normal operational capacity.

2) The main objective of stress testing is to identify the software's breaking point and analyze how it behaves under high loads, extreme inputs, or inadequate resources.

3) Stress testing helps in determining the system's reliability, scalability, and potential points of failure when subjected to heavy workloads.

4) This type of testing is crucial for ensuring that the software can handle maximum user loads, sudden spikes in traffic, or prolonged usage without crashing or malfunctioning.

5) By exposing the software to stress conditions, testers can analyze its performance metrics, such as response time, resource utilization, and memory leaks.

6) Stress testing is often performed using tools that simulate real world scenarios to push the software beyond its limits and observe its behavior under stressful conditions.

7) Common stress testing techniques include load testing, spike testing, and endurance testing, each focusing on different aspects of the software's performance under stress.

8) Stress testing helps in detecting issues related to concurrency, data consistency, transaction integrity, and system bottlenecks that may arise under heavy loads.

9) It is important to carefully plan and design stress tests to mimic realistic usage patterns and identify potential performance bottlenecks early in the software development lifecycle.

10) The results of stress testing can provide valuable insights for optimizing the software's architecture, improving its performance, and enhancing the overall user experience.

11) Students interested in learning stress testing can benefit from a comprehensive training program that covers the theoretical concepts and practical aspects of stress testing methodologies.

12) The training program should include hands on exercises, case studies, and real world examples to help students understand the importance of stress testing in ensuring software reliability and performance.

13) Students should learn how to design and execute stress tests, analyze the results, and make recommendations for optimizing software performance based on the test findings.

14) The training program can also cover various stress testing tools and techniques commonly used in the industry, providing students with practical skills for effective software testing practices.

15) Overall, a well structured training program on stress testing can equip students with the necessary knowledge and skills to evaluate software performance under stress conditions and contribute to delivering high quality, reliable software products.

 

Browse our course links : https://www.justacademy.co/all-courses 

To Join our FREE DEMO Session: Click Here 

Contact Us for more info:

How To Connect Mysql With Node Js

Java 8 Interview Questions For Experienced

Difference Between Static And Final In Java

Free Php Training

Kotlin Android Interview Questions

Connect With Us
Where To Find Us
Testimonials
whttp://www.w3.org/2000/svghatsapp